BARHOISE BURN | Barhoise Burn Barhose Burn Barhose Burn Barhose Burn |
See Plan 13C William Cumming James Milroy Peter Gordon |
012 | [Situation] In the Southern part of the Parish and NE [North East] of the Halfway House. A considerable Stream rising on Culvennan Fell runs in a South Easterly direction crosses the Coach Road from Glenluce to Newtonstewart and enters the River Bladenoch near Barlennan |
WELLPARK BURN | Wellpark Burn Wellpark Burn |
Peter Gordon William Cumming |
012 | [Situation] In the Southern part of the Parish and NE [North East] of the Halfway House. A small Stream rising in the Moors of Fell End farm it runs in an easterly direction through the farm of Drumbuie and falls into the Barhoise Burn to the east of the Farm House of Drumbuie. |
BALLOCHRAE BURN | Ballochrae Burn Ballochrae Burn Ballochrae Burn Ballachrae |
Samuel Brady James McNairn Thomas McCormick Ainslie's Map 1782 |
012 | [Situation] In the Southern part of the Parish and West of the Halfway House. A small stream rising in the moors of Kildarroch or Fell End, runs in a Southerly direction crosses the Old Military road at the Moss House Bridge and the Mail Coach Road at Craighlaw Bridge from thence to Craighlaw Pond and ultimately to the River Tarf. See Plan 18B. |
